🌟 Positive Degree — Daily Use Question Sentences

✨ The Positive Degree is used when we compare two people or things equally, using the structure as + adjective + as.

These sentences are very useful in daily conversations, so let’s practice with simple and natural examples.

Is the coffee as strong as you like it?
Is this chair as soft as the sofa?
Are the students as attentive as yesterday?
Is your bag as organized as your friend’s?
Is this road as smooth as the highway?
Is the weather as cool as last week?
Are the apples as sweet as the ones from the market?
Is your room as tidy as the living room?
Is the juice as cold as you expected?
Is the soup as tasty as the one at the restaurant?
Are the shoes as stylish as the new collection?
Is the park as clean as the playground?
Is your phone as fast as the latest model?
Is the classroom as bright as the library?
Is the street as quiet as the village road?
Are the books as informative as the online articles?
Is this bag as waterproof as the one you bought last month?
Is the pillow as soft as your favorite one?
Is the movie as dramatic as the last one you watched?
Is the cake as delicious as the bakery one?
